Understanding NASA's Perseverance Rover Mission

The Perseverance rover is a key part of NASA's Mars Exploration Program. Its primary goals include searching for signs of ancient microbial life, collecting samples of Martian rock and regolith for future return to Earth, studying the geology and climate of Mars, and preparing for human exploration.

Sample collection is a crucial part of the mission. The rover is equipped with a coring drill and sample tubes to extract materials that represent the geological history of its landing site, Jezero Crater.

First Successful Sample Collection by Perseverance

After an initial attempt in August 2021 where the rock proved too crumbly, NASA's Perseverance rover successfully collected its first Mars sample on September 7, 2021. This was a significant milestone in the mission.

The mission team confirmed that the rover had successfully drilled, extracted, and sealed a sample from a Martian rock. This rock was part of a ridge nicknamed "Rochette" within the Jezero Crater.

Additional Information on Perseverance Sample Collection

The samples collected by Perseverance are intended to be part of the Mars Sample Return campaign, a multi-mission effort led by NASA and ESA (European Space Agency). These samples are considered precious resources that will be brought back to Earth for in-depth analysis in laboratories.

Scientists hope that studying these meticulously selected samples on Earth will provide definitive answers about the geological history of Mars and whether life ever existed there. The Jezero Crater is believed to have been a lake billions of years ago, making it an ideal location to search for biosignatures within the ancient rocks.
